Reasons for Carter County Schools Closings
Carter County Schools closings occur for a variety of reasons, ranging from inclement weather to emergency situations. Below are some of the most common reasons:
- Inclement Weather: Snow, ice, and heavy rain can make roads unsafe for buses and commuters.
- Utility Failures: Power outages or water issues can disrupt normal school operations.
- Health Emergencies: Outbreaks of contagious diseases may necessitate temporary closures.
- Structural Issues: Building repairs or maintenance can require schools to close temporarily.
Each situation is assessed carefully by district officials to ensure the safety of students and staff.

Communication Channels for Updates
Staying informed about Carter County Schools closings is essential for parents and students. The district utilizes several communication channels to disseminate information quickly and effectively:
- Website: The official Carter County Schools website is the primary source of updates.
- Social Media: Platforms like Facebook and Twitter provide real-time notifications.
- Email Alerts: Parents can sign up for email notifications through the district's system.
- Local News Outlets: Radio and television stations often broadcast closure announcements.
Utilizing these channels ensures that everyone remains aware of any changes in school schedules.

Historical Data on Carter County School Closings
Examining historical data on Carter County Schools closings provides valuable insights into trends and patterns. According to records, the district has experienced an average of 5-7 closures per year over the past decade. The majority of these closures were due to inclement weather.
By analyzing this data, district officials can better prepare for future events and implement strategies to reduce disruptions.
